October 20, 200916 yr I've tried to search the Intraweb, and I found this forum, but I just grenaded my Manual 5spd Tranny in my 2000 Impreza L. 3.90 final yadda yadda yadda.. I found a 95 3.9 transmission for cheap, but it's an OBD I tranny.. Will this work, or will I have to find a OBD II Transmission? Please OB1, you are my only hope!
October 21, 200916 yr I just installed an OBD-I 5 speed into a '96 OBD-II. The biggest difference was the exhaust bracket for the mid-pipe. The bosses on the tranmission for the mount simply didn't exist. I fabed up a mount and welded it to part of the transmission cross-member. The wireing is different but I just swapped the reverse and neutral switches with the one's from the blown tranny. Otherwise it bolted right up. They were both cable clutch's and both 3.9's. YMMV with a 2000 though. GD
